Germany, Zew index weaker than expected

The indicator on the prospects of the German and European economy dropped more than expected in November. The figure demonstrates how uncertainty is spreading among economics experts.

The Zew index on German economic prospects fell more than expected. It settled at -55,2 in November, up from -48,3 in October, while the estimated value was -52. The Zew is an indicator built on the judgments of 350 experts and is extremely volatile.

The sub-index on current economic conditions also fell from 38,4 to 34,2. The Zew institute has announced that the crisis in Greece and Italy has contributed to the drop in confidence, as well as the slowdown in international trade.
